Editorial Reviews:

Product Description
The 100-Piece Super Took Kit is intended for handling of standard PC and office machine maintenance. Unique 2-in-1 bits offer 2 sizes in 1 bit. The combination design uses both metric and standard measurement in one. The combination sizes include 3/16" (5mm), 1/4" (6mm), 5/16" (8mm), 11/32" (9mm), 3/8" (10mm).Kit also includes: 3-way, fully flexible ratchet driver, 6 piece precision screwdriver kit, 4 AA batteries, wire stripper, brush, precision pen knife, diagonal cutting pliers, chip extractor, needle nose pliers, 3-pronged parts retriever, voltage tester, flashlight, crimp and strip wire stripper, spare parts container, surface cleaning wipes, cable ties, wrist band, 5 torx bits, adapter bit, #1 pozidriver bit, 2 slotted bits, 4 square bits, 2 phillips bits, 8 hollow star bits, 6 piece hex key set, 6 piece metric hex key set, 4 piece spanner set, tri-wing set, allen wrench set, insulated tape and vinyl zipper case.

1 out of 5 stars Don't expect to accomplish much with this cheaply made toolkit   May 19, 2007
 3 out of 3 found this review helpful

I'm surprised at the positive reviews of this toolkit that I've read here. It's as if other folks received a different tool kit than the one I got.

As another reviewer says, to begin with you can throw away the vacuum, which is too weak to clean even a keyboard - it's as cheaply made as a toy you might get from a gum machine. Same with the flashlight.

The centerpiece of the outfit - the ratcheting screwdriver - is a fiasco. It has a potentially nice feature that lets you change the angle of the ratcheting head, but the feature is so poorly implemented that most of the time the shaft works itself loose - so it jiggles from side to side out of line with the handle - and you have to be constantly retightening a retaining screw in order to use the driver. Within the first three minutes I used this driver, I was longing for an ordinary screwdriver. In addition, there is a plastic screw-cap that holds the end of the ratchet mechanism in place, and it often falls off while you are tightening or loosening a screw. It's hard to imagine what a frustrating device this is until you've tried to accomplish something with it.

The kit comes with a couple dozen types of driver bits. But why does it have more three-pronged bits (say wha-a-a-t?) than regular Phillips bits? With only three Phillips bits, you seldom have the right head for the most common type of screws, so it's easy to strip a screw. (I've been using tools like these for thirty years, and know how to tighten a screw properly). And, if the screw is at all tight, the bit strips itself very easily - the bits are obviously made of cheap-grade metal, nowhere near professional quality, and not intended for extended use.

I haven't had need to use the Allen wrenches, but they appear to be made of cheap chrome-plated metal, instead of the black spring-steel you would find in a similar tool at your local hardware store. The small box wrenches also appear to made of cheaply forged chrome-plated material.

This toolkit has all the earmarks of the kind of low-budget set that should sell for less than $20, at the most, or might sell as a "gift" item because it has some pretty chromed items and a couple cute (but useless) toys with it.

If you want a toolkit that you can use for serious work around computers, just pass this one by. I'm going to see if I can return it, now that I've seen it in action. Ugh.



5 out of 5 stars Awesome usefull tools for a great price   May 16, 2007
I have looked at and used many computer repair tool kits. This has been by far the best kit I have used. It has the most useful tools in a nice compact design and a great price. The precision set screw drivers have too fragile a heads, but which precision set does not. Also, the flash light it comes with is basically useless for computer repair.. as it does NOT have enough power to be useful inside a computer case. I recommend you pick up a super-bright LED flash light to use for working inside the case when it is not 100% bright in the room.
